#725c7d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#725c7d is composed of 44.7% red, 36.1%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.8% cyan, 26.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 280 degrees, a saturation of 15.2% and a lightness of 42.5%. #725c7d color hex could be obtained by blending #e4b8f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#725c7d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f6f4f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#725c7d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6475 is the less saturated color, while #9100d9 is the most saturated one.
